  • hey im a newish slider and im looking for a slide deck. Any suggestions? and nice vid. any sugestions are helpful =]

  • Earthwing Drifter.

    I have not tried the Earthwing Decks, but their wheels are for sure the best sliding wheels (smooth ride too).

    I use lots of Old Schools for sliding since they're wider and usually have that fish shape so I have leverage on the front for pivoting on it, and that Gradually widening tail I can use for check slides and use the skinnier part closer to the middle for extra leverage on shove-its.

  • hey i was wonderin were to get those knee pucks are those brand bought or rigged ? plzz respond THX!

  • Actually those are just standard knee pads. If you are looking for the best, get the 187 pro pads or see if they will make you custom slide pads with side pucks (about $150). Or just glue some pucks onto the side of your pads with shoo goo.

  • im ordering a drifter pretty soon here and i was wondering if i should get their new 58mm Slide A balls or stick with the 62mm slide wheels?

  • you certainly can't go wrong with the 62mm's for sliding. the 58mm's are the same urethane and core, just a little smaller. the 58's will have a slight advantage for ollies because they are lighter. for sliding only, i doubt you'll notice the difference. they will both be excellent. hope this helps!
